The EMG Conversion Kit (PJ Set) is the wiring harness for installing an EMG active PJ Bass pickup set (a Precision split-coil at the neck plus a Jazz single-coil at the bridge) without soldering. The kit ships with the 25K low-impedance pots that EMG's active bass circuit needs to see, wired to the standard PJ control layout of volume, blend or volume, tone, along with a pre-terminated output jack, a battery clip and the solderless quick-connect cables that plug the P split-coil and the J single-coil into the harness. Within the wider EMG Conversion Kit family it sits alongside the J Set kit for two-matched-J-pickup Jazz Bass configurations and the guitar-format 1/2 PU active kits. The choice between the PJ Set kit and the J Set kit is set by the pickups in the bass: a Precision split-coil plus a Jazz bridge single-coil uses the PJ Set kit; two matched Jazz single-coils use the J Set kit. The 25K pot value on the active kits is not interchangeable with 250K passive values, so the harness must match the pickups. Fits any PJ-format bass routed for a Precision split-coil at the neck and a Jazz single-coil at the bridge, both from EMG's active range. Runs on a single 9V battery shared between both EMG actives on the harness. Distributed and supported in the UK by Selectron.
